Installing and Removing Options
You
can
enhance
the
performance
of your
computer
by
adding
optional
equipment
such
as
memory
modules,
ISA
or
VL-Bus
option
cards,
or
a
microprocessor
upgrade.
This
chapter
describes
how
to
install
and
remove
these
options,
as
well
as
how
to
change
the
jumper
and
DIP
switch
settings
inside
the
computer.
You
may
need
to
change
these
settings
if
you
install
options
or
if you
want
to
change
the
way
your
system
operates.
